Finding the outright least expensive rate requires a little strategy. Consumers who hurry into a purchase frequently miss out on out on concealed savings. To make the most of value, consider the following techniques:
- Look for "Tool-Only" Options: If a purchaser currently owns cordless tool batteries from a particular brand (like Milwaukee or DeWalt), they ought to acquire "tool-only" (bare tool) variations. This removes the cost of redundant batteries and chargers.
- Shop Certified Refurbished: Factory-remanufactured Tools Online UK are products that were returned, inspected, repaired, and evaluated to meet original factory requirements. They frequently feature steep discount rates (often 30% to 50% off) and still consist of a producer warranty.
- Time Purchases Around Major Holidays: Tool prices plunge throughout specific times of the year. The finest periods to buy low-cost power tools online include:
- Father's Day (June)
- Black Friday and Cyber Monday (November)
- Memorial Day and Labor Day weekends
- Spring clearance events (as retailers clear area for new inventory)
- Utilize Price Trackers: Browser extensions and sites like CamelCamelCamel enable consumers to track the price history of products on Amazon. This ensures a "sale" is in fact a great offer.
Red Flags: What to Avoid When Buying Cheap Tools Online
While saving money is the main objective, cheap must never suggest harmful or completely unreliable. Watch out for these common online shopping mistakes:
- Unknown, No-Name Brands: Be mindful of ultra-cheap tools from obscure brand names including a random assortment of capital letters. These tools often utilize inferior plastics, weak motors, and position security risks due to a lack of safety certifications (such as UL or ETL listings).
- Too-Good-to-Be-True Prices: If a high-end ₤ 300 brushless effect motorist is noted new for ₤ 40 on a sketchy third-party site, it is likely a scam or a dangerous counterfeit.
- Missing Out On Return Policies: Always examine the return policy before buying from an unknown online supplier. Reputable sellers use a minimum of a 30-day return window.
Vital Power Tools for a Budget-Friendly Starter Kit
For those building a toolkit from scratch, it helps to focus on versatile tools that can handle multiple jobs.
- Cordless Drill/Driver: The absolute backbone of any toolkit. Look for an 18V or 20V lithium-ion design for an excellent balance of power and battery life.
- Circular Saw: Ideal for breaking down big sheets of plywood, framing lumber, and making straight cuts.
- Random Orbit Sander: Essential for woodworking and surface preparation, ensuring a smooth surface with minimal effort.
- Reciprocating Saw: Great for demolition work, cutting through PVC pipelines, and pruning tree branches.
Buying these tools as part of a combo kit is typically significantly less expensive than acquiring each item individually. Combination packages often consist of a charger and 2 batteries, providing incredible general worth.
Often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Are refurbished power tools safe to buy?
Yes, supplied they are licensed factory-remanufactured and feature a warranty. Avoid uncertified used tools from unidentified online sellers unless you are comfortable fixing them yourself.
2. Should I buy brushed or brushless power tools to save cash?
Brushed motors are normally cheaper upfront, making them excellent for occasional DIY users. Brushless motors cost more initially, however they use much better energy effectiveness, longer run times, and extended tool life. For heavy use, brushless is a better long-term financial investment.
3. How can I prevent buying counterfeit power tools online?
Adhere to authorized dealers, official manufacturer shops, or popular home improvement sites. If purchasing from Amazon, ensure the item is "Shipped from and Sold by Amazon.com" rather than an unproven third-party marketplace seller.
4. Are cheap online power tool batteries trusted?
It is normally suggested to stick to O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er) batteries or trusted third-party brand names that specialize in safety-certified replacements. Low-cost, off-brand lithium-ion batteries bought online can overheat, hold poor charges, and position fire risks.
